About Rain

RAIN is the native token of Rain Protocol, a decentralized prediction market platform on Arbitrum where users can create and participate in markets based on verifiable real-world events. The protocol uses an automated market maker to price market outcomes. RAIN provides access to prediction markets, supports protocol governance through the Rain DAO, and rewards market creators, liquidity providers, and resolvers.

About Viction

Viction, formerly TomoChain, is a people-centric layer-1 blockchain offering zero-gas transactions and enhanced security to make Web3 easy and safe for everyone. Designed with a focus on user experience, Viction prioritizes zero-gas transactions, speed, security, and scalability to create a more secure and open world.
